Silchar college of education located in Assam is an institution which offers B.Ed or Bachelor of Education in a semester system, wherein in there are six semesters, two years, its fee structure includes, college development fee, tuition fee, guest lecturer fees and so on, which all totals upto Rs.7,345 for the first year and Rs. 4,195 for the second year.

YCMOU, also known as YashwantRao Chawan Maharashtra Open University, is an open University located in Nashik, Maharashtra. The course B.Ed Special Education is a two year course wherein first required to have completed their graduation in order to take admission. The cut-off score of 2022 was at an average 118.83 in round 1.

Bhoj Opem University is one of the most reputed Open University, not just in Madhya Pradesh but also all across India. It offers Bachelor of Education but not Bachelor of Special Education. B.Ed is a two-year course being offered at about Rs.36,000 in total. There application process starts around at the end of November and ends in mid December. They're regional centers are laid across the entire state of Madhya Pradesh, chinddhwara ,jabalpur, dhapara, to name a few.

KP Training College is a co-educational institution located in the holy city of Allahabad at the confluence of the Ganges, the Yamuna and the invisible Saraswati, it is one of the oldest teacher training institutions in the state and is managed by the Kayastha Pathshala Trust which is believed to. to be the country's largest educational trust.
The latest cut off for bachelor of education (B.Ed.) for the year 2022-23 was 145 for general category arts stream,148 for general category science stream as per the college information.

B.Ed or Bachelor of Education is a two-year course fir those willing to make a career in teaching or education. It's fees ranges from about Rs. 25,000 to Rs.55,000 per annum depending upon the college or university. Those willing to do the course are required to have completed their graduation. After completing B.Ed one becomes eligible to at least teach upto secondary and even senior secondary classes.
